WHO IS THAT GOD?  In Daniel 3:15, we see that Nebuchadnezzar, King of Babylon, having brought the three Hebrew Children into his presence, Shadrach, Meshach, and Abed-nego, he asks the question:  "...and who is that God that shall deliver you out of my hands?"  Well, he was to find out.  He was the God who is powerful.  Our first name of God in the Bible is Elohim.  The Almighty!  That is our God.  He had the power to protect and preserve the children of Israel, and He did.  These young men know.  They said:  "our God whom we serve is able to deliver us from the burning fiery furnace, and he will deliver us out of thine hand, O King."  They knew this God that Nebuchadnezzar did not.  He is the God who is personal.  The name Jehovah is God's name revealed to His people.  It is a covenant name.  It is like saying "papa".  It is God saying to His people, you can call me.... Jehovah.  God wants a personal relationship with all of His people, and He has that with each of us.  Later in Daniel, Nebuchadnezzar would learn, who is that God.  The king would later say:  "there is no other God that can deliver after this sort."  And again, "Now I Nebuchadnezzar praise and extol and honour the King of heaven, all whose works are truth, and his ways judgment:  and those that walk in pride he is able to abase."  Well, you can see, he found the answer to his question:  Who is that God?  I'm glad we too know the answer to that question!
